Mozilla Firefox 52.0 is available on Mozilla's public FTP server. Firefox 53.0 won't run on XP or Vista machines anymore. Windows XP and Vista users are automatically migrated to Firefox 52.0 ESR during update.You may enable NPAPI plugin support in it. Firefox ESR 52.0 is the new Extended Support Release version.So, no Silverlight, Java, Google Hangouts and other plugin support anymore. The new version does not support NPAPI plugins anymore, apart from Adobe Flash.Firefox 52.0 is the new stable version of the web browser.Additionally, Firefox ESR 52.0 is available (and so is Firefox ESR 45.8). This means that Firefox Beta is updated to Beta 53.0, Firefox Aurora to Aurora 54.0, and Firefox Nightly to Nightly 55.0. Mozilla updates all Firefox channels on the same day when a new major stable version is released. Second, it marks the beginning of a new Firefox Extended Support Release (ESR) cycle. First, it is the first release that does away with NPAPI plugin support. The new version of Firefox is a major release for several reasons.
